Hey All,

Been out of the scene for a very long time. I flashed my fat benq drive a few years ago when I was in college using a VIA card. While in college my system got banned for running backups. I am looking to upgrade to the newest CFW but dont really know the newest procedures or what the best CFW version is I am looking for.

Since I dont need live access is there a firmware that doesnt need all the checks?

Im just looking for a CFW that can play my newer backups. We dont allow my youngest onto Xbox live.

I have used jungleflasher in the past and still have a backup of my DVD key.

Thanks for the help,

Older Modder


The last version of custom firmware for the benq was LT Plus-benq-v1.1, this will play latest XGD3 backups. Suggest you download the latest jungleflasher and guide first and have a read up. I would return the drive back to stock firmware first then manually update the dashboard to the latest version before putting the custom firmware on the drive. You should still be good to go with your via chipset.
